Job Summary
SMSI is hiring multiple Senior Project Controls Schedulers to work on a new contract. These positions will be primarily remote but require travel to delivery sites as needed. The candidates will be responsible for leading planning/scheduling activities for a sub-group, team, project, program or staff planning activities that require a high degree of technical skill and experience. Directs schedule development, maintenance, monitoring, impact identification, and recovery plan development activities. Provides generally non-routine planning and scheduling guidance. Identifies, analyzes, and provides innovative solutions to planning/scheduling problems. This position will be remote with periodic travel to vendor facilities. Candidates must reside in one of the following states: Wyoming, Utah, Colorado or Nebraska.
